I just received form CP501 from the IRS stating taxes are due for 2022.  Also stated was interest for unpaid taxes dating back to 5/22/23, however I never received a notice of taxes due after filing. All taxes were paid as calculated by Turbo Tax for the 2022 tax year. The tax due notice does not specify why I owed more taxes that was calculated by Turbo Tax. Do I have any recourse other than to pay the balance requested by the IRS?

    Understanding Your CP501 Notice

    What this notice is about

    You received this notice because you have a balance due (money you owe the IRS) on one of your tax accounts.

    View this notice and manage your communication preference online

    Sign in to your Online Account to:

    • View and download this notice
    • Go paperless for certain notices
    • Get email notifications for new notices

    What you need to do

    • Read your notice carefully. It explains how much you owe, when your payment is due, and your payment options.
    • Pay the amount you owe by the due date shown on the notice.
    • Make a payment plan if you can't pay the full amount you owe.
    • Contact us if you disagree by calling the toll-free number shown on your notice.

    One thing,  If you had a tax penalty on 1040 line 38 that is only an estimated amount and it is common for the IRS to bill you for more.
